Murphy Oil (NYSE:MUR) Trading Down 7.7% on Analyst Downgrade

by · The Markets Daily

Murphy Oil Corporation (NYSE:MURGet Free Report) shares were down 7.7% during mid-day trading on Tuesday after Zacks Research downgraded the stock from a hold rating to a strong sell rating. The company traded as low as $31.07 and last traded at $31.3160. Approximately 779,902 shares changed hands during trading, a decline of 67% from the average daily volume of 2,361,128 shares. The stock had previously closed at $33.92.

Murphy Oil Price Performance

The firm has a market capitalization of $4.45 billion, a P/E ratio of 31.82 and a beta of 0.78. The business’s 50-day simple moving average is $31.80 and its 200 day simple moving average is $28.26. The company has a quick ratio of 0.87, a current ratio of 0.94 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.27.

Murphy Oil (NYSE:MURGet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ings data on Wednesday, November 5th. The oil and gas producer reported $0.41 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, beating analysts’ consensus estimates of $0.16 by $0.25. The company had revenue of $720.97 million during the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$648.80 million. Murphy Oil had a net margin of 5.16% and a return on equity of 4.30%. The firm’s revenue was down 3.3% on a year-over-year basis. During the same quarter in the prior year, the company earned $0.74 EPS. Sell-side analysts forecast that Murphy Oil Corporation will post 2.94 earnings per share for the current year.

Murphy Oil Company Profile

(Get Free Report)

Murphy Oil Corporation is an independent upstream oil and gas company engaged in the exploration, development and production of crude oil, natural gas and natural gas liquids. The company’s operations encompass conventional onshore and offshore reservoirs, with an emphasis on liquids-rich properties and deepwater assets. Through a combination of proprietary technologies and strategic joint ventures, Murphy Oil seeks to optimize recovery rates and manage its portfolio to balance long-term resource development with operational flexibility.

Murphy Oil’s exploration and production activities are geographically diversified.
